What We Need

We are looking for a Bilingual Client Success Specialist (FPS Partner) to join Element Fleet Management. As the largest pure-play fleet manager in the world, we provide unmatched products and services and solutions to our clients.

At Element, employees play a critical role in delivering value to customers and ensuring an exceptional client experience. We are committed to the success of our clients, employees, and investors by fostering a culture where every employee can make a difference

Are You:
- Driven by servicing clients with the highest level of customer service?- Someone who thrives in a fast-paced, ever-evolving and highly visible environment?

As the Client Success Specialist you will build and maintain relationships with our customers and provide ongoing day to day account support, recommending cost saving solutions and managing processes to optimize the productivity of their fleet. You will also contribute to the client’s ability to achieve their company goals, as well as to Element Fleet’s attainment of account retention and growth objectives.

A Day in the Life- Work with customers and internal cross-functional teams to develop the account strategy that best suites the customers’ needs and goals.- Executes day-to-day requests and activities, complex or routine, in accordance with client’s policies, procedures and priorities.- Uses discretion and independent judgment advising clients and works with client to recognize need and recommend solutions.- Takes ownership of client issues and applies critical thinking and problem-solving abilities.- Customer data analysis and/or reporting**Requirements**:
- BS or BA in business or related field is required. Equivalent relevant experience will be considered in lieu of a degree.- Must be fully bilingual in English and French- 2-5 years customer service or client account management experience is highly desirable, preferably in a B2B service environment- Strong preference for experiences in Fleet/ Transportation/ Logistics industries*Internally, this role is referred to as FPS Partner*

The hiring base salary range for this position is $62,600 and $86,020 annually. Actual compensation within this range will be dependent upon the individual’s knowledge, skills, experience, equity with other team members, and alignment with market data.
